In Christianity, a bishop is an ordained member of the clergy who is entrusted with a position of authority and oversight in a religious institution. Bishops are normally responsible for the governance and administration of dioceses, although some function in the various Christian denominations and traditions as auxiliaries, apostolic administrators, and as titular bishops.
